MOBILE, Ala. – Sophomore
Katja Mueller led Little Rock with a 1-under 71 in round two of the USA Intercollegiate, held at Magnolia Grove Golf Club. The Trojans matched their opening round total of 3-over 291 and sits tied for eighth with a 6-over 582 after 36 holes.

Mueller opened round two with pars on the front nine before birdies on 10 and 16, with a bogey on 12 the lone blemish of the day, en route to her 1-under 71. She was one of two Trojans to finish at par-or-better on the afternoon, joined by grad student
Kellie Gachaga's even-par 72, comprised of three birdies and 12 pars on the day.
Junior
Agatha Alesson continues to lead the Little Rock scorecard with an even-par 144 following her second-round 74, tied for 19th among the individual leaders. Gachaga is tied for 23rd with her 1-over 145 through round two, followed by Mueller tied for 29th with a 2-over 146.
Junior
Viktoria Krnacova registered a 6-over 78 in round two, sitting at 7-over 141, followed by sophomore
Anna Dawson's 2-over 74, as she is at 8-over 152 through 36 holes.
Little Rock slipped one spot in the team standings despite the 3-over 291, tied for eighth with Houston Baptist and one shot back of seventh-place Georgia State (5-over 581). The Trojans enter Monday's final round two shots back of sixth-place Southern Miss (4-over 580) and hold a one shot lead on 10th-place Middle Tennessee (7-over 583).
Host South Alabama maintains the team lead, sitting at 15-under 561 and holding an eight shot lead on second-place Arkansas State (7-under 569). ULM and Memphis are both tied for third (6-under 570) with Western Kentucky (3-under 573) rounding out the top-five, as well as the teams under par.
Monday's final round will get underway with an 8 a.m. tee time on hole one for Little Rock with the Trojans playing with Georgia State and Houston Baptist. Dawson will tee off first for the Trojans, leading up to Alesson's 8:36 a.m. tee time. Live scoring is available at GolfStat.com.
